#182d4b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#182d4b is composed of 9.4% red, 17.6%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68% cyan, 40% magenta, 0%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 215.3 degrees, a saturation of 51.5% and a lightness of 19.4%. #182d4b color hex could be obtained by blending #305a96 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#182d4b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f1f5f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#182d4b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f3134 is the less saturated color, while #012962 is the most saturated one.
